Good for my needs.
Overall the vehicle was good for my needs. I attend a lot of craft shows so I need room to carry my goods. It handles well on wet and snowy roads. Maintenance relatively low. So far just had to have our changes and air conditioner fixed. I do wish it had more back room for hauling but I won't complain. Seats are comfortable and easy to clean. Child safety locks are wonderful when you haul the little ones. Plenty of leg room front and back.

It just keeps going
I have owned my car for over ten years and never once have I had a major problem with it. Everything has worn very well, and it's been a super reliable car. The car currently has 178,000 miles- I've had it since it only had 48,000 miles on it- and it has never broken down or had a major repair issue. I dislike the fact that it does not have four-wheel drive, but it has been safe in the snow. About once a year the car will shut off on it's own at stoplights, but it always starts right back up. The air conditioning has had to been charged a couple times, I'm not sure if it's a typical issue or how often most cars have to be recharged. My Trailblazer has had the common issue of burning up the heating and cooling fan - that's been replaced twice. I like the fact that it's a roomy, family friendly car. I do wish the trim options were more and I'd have preferred an extended version of the car, but I guess some people are happy with the five seats. I do think that being able to have the option to have five or eight seats with the same look and feel. I do have to say that I'm disappointed to know that Chevy stopped making the vehicle in 2008, because I would absolutely have bought another Trailblazer when this one needs to be replaced - you still see a lot of them on the road.
